    Question on Download/Upload speed

    Okay so recently I switched my internet to the best possible in my area. which is 50mb Download and 5mb Upload.

    When i was downloading games tho it would be at 5-7mbps. Don't wanna sound like a noob but I was thinking the download would be near 50 right?

    When I download will the speed at which I download stuff be towards the Upload and not download?

    Your ISP advertises things as megaBITS while software announces download speed in megaBYTES.

    What you should have is 50/8 = 6.25 megaBYTES maximum download speed. 7mbps is little too high actually, 5-6mbps would sound about right.

    I'm fairly certain that you're mixing up Mbps and MegaBytes/sec.

    As Vesse said, it's 50 Megabit / 8 bits = 6.25 MegaBytes/sec as your maximum.

    Do note that servers/peer(s) may not be able to sustain that for you, so it may not necessarily be your own line that is bad either.
